New wing pulley solves old problems, and extends belt life on conveyors

The new Chevron Wing Pulley is engineered to solve problems linked with the decades-old wing pulley design used on conveyors. Tests prove the new V-shape wing pulley deflects rocks and other fugitive material away from belts quicker. The result prevents wing tipping and extends belt life. The round bar wing cap design provides extra belt support and reduces both vibration and noise by at least fifty decibels. Combined, users save time and money, stopping shutdowns and prolonging the life of their belts.
The patent pending Chevron Wing Pulley is designed for users who want more reliability and fewer repairs. It is available in Superior CEMA and super duty speci-fications Also recently available, the CEMA F idler line as a solution to extreme material capacities and material size in the bulk material handling industry. Superior’s engineered idlers are custom built per application for maximum wear life and reliability The CEMA F idler features 20-, 30-, and45 degree troughing idlers, available in seven- and eight-inch diameters, and in belt widths of 36- to 96 inches. The 3,000-pound (2,800 pounds. on 96-inch belt width) load rating on troughing idlers is based on a minimum L10 life of 60,000 hours at 500 RPM.
